Norrie Posted April 10, 2016 Share Posted April 10, 2016 This picture was taken by me at the Argyle and Sutherland Highlanders museum in Stirling Castle...it was only while reading the caption, I realised that is was a story told to me by the writer, Duncan Ferguson, an old friend of mine, who suffered much degradation at the hands of the Japanese after the fall of Signapore. So much so, that when he was offered "reparations" by the Japanese Govt , he told them where to put it...:) The stories he used to tell me made my toes curl....he wanted to let everyone know what it was like.....What a great man he was...:) 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
